South Korea has long stood as a global powerhouse in the semiconductor industry, with giants like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ix driving continuous innovation and manufacturing excellence. Within this ecosystem, the wafer ring frame market in South Korea is witnessing a steady rise in importance, playing a pivotal role in wafer handling, packaging, and inspection processes that determine the final quality and yield of semiconductor devices.
A wafer ring frame serves as a crucial support mechanism that holds and secures semiconductor wafers during dicing and packaging operations. As semiconductor devices become smaller, more complex, and more performance-oriented, the need for precision handling of wafers has become vital. In South Korea, where advanced chip production and R&D activities are expanding, demand for high-quality, durable, and contamination-free wafer ring frames is accelerating.
Driving Forces Behind Market Growth
The primary catalyst for South Korea’s wafer ring frame market is the strong domestic semiconductor manufacturing base. The country’s commitment to technological leadership ensures constant investment in advanced wafer processing equipment and automation. The adoption of next-generation chips for AI, automotive electronics, 5G, and memory applications has led to higher wafer throughput and tighter manufacturing tolerances. Consequently, wafer ring frames designed with superior dimensional accuracy, stability, and compatibility with high-speed equipment are becoming indispensable.
Another significant factor is the emphasis on cleanroom standards and contamination control. South Korean fabs are implementing stricter process requirements to enhance yield rates. This shift is pushing suppliers to develop wafer ring frames with enhanced surface smoothness, anti-static properties, and materials resistant to outgassing and deformation. Manufacturers are increasingly turning to composite materials, stainless steel, and engineered polymers that provide both strength and flexibility.
Technological Advancements and Customization Trends
Innovation in wafer frame materials and design is reshaping the competitive landscape. South Korean suppliers are investing in research to create lighter yet more rigid frame designs, allowing for greater precision during high-speed dicing. Moreover, the integration of smart tracking systems and automation-friendly features into wafer frames is becoming a trend, aligning with the broader move toward smart factories and Industry 4.0 within the semiconductor sector.
Customization has also become a defining trend. With different chipmakers requiring specific wafer sizes and unique dicing methods, the market is seeing a shift toward tailor-made ring frame solutions. Local producers are collaborating closely with semiconductor equipment manufacturers to deliver frames optimized for their machines and processes, enhancing operational efficiency.
